U.S. Immigration Raid

South Korea to send foreign minister to U.S. after Hyundai worker detentions

South Korea Foreign Minister Cho Hyun heads to the U.S. on Monday to discuss visa reforms after 300 Korean workers were detained in a massive immigration raid at Hyundai-LG Energy Solution’s (LGES) $4.3 billion battery plant in Georgia. Authorities plan to fly the workers home later this week.

Azerbaijan & China

Azerbaijan-China visa-free travel deal enters into force

A mutual visa exemption agreement between Azerbaijan and China took effect on Wednesday (16 July), allowing ordinary passport holders to travel without a visa for short stays. The move marks a milestone in bilateral relations, strengthening tourism, business, and cultural ties.
